I am almost finished with my thesis, but I have a problem I haven't been able to fix regarding the spacing of List of Figures (and List of Tables) entries. The formatting requirements require that all entries in these lists must have a space between each other.

The current template only places a space between entries that change chapter. All the chapter 2 entries have no spacing between each other, but the last chapter 2 figure description and the first chapter 3 figure have a space between each other. I need this spacing to go between all entries regardless of chapter.

I'm a noob when it comes to the nitty gritty of latex templates, so I have no idea how this fine-grained behavior is specified in the template or how I would fix it. Any help would be greatly appreciated.
